IP查询
查询
你查询的IP:[123.206.209.142] 地理位置:中国–上海–上海
最新查询
117.60.7.188
59.32.1.145
59.192.55.43
221.125.147.27
119.58.111.206
218.177.6.46
119.28.179.231
210.2.164.205
121.58.186.142
123.206.209.142
202.41.152.1
203.88.192.241
122.152.192.234
119.42.136.138
210.76.234.241
221.129.193.150
202.192.186.34
116.69.80.28
116.255.128.186
122.119.207.150
222.125.73.215
123.98.43.121
202.41.152.124
124.249.80.223
58.99.128.192
162.105.47.169
203.100.192.228
123.101.52.8
124.20.254.224
114.60.5.197
210.15.128.40